ELISA kits are commonly used to measure soluble biomarkers across a variety of research areas. ELISA kits for Melatonin are available for Human and Mouse which can be quantified in various samples, including plasma, serum.
Invitrogen ELISA kits exist in two formats: Uncoated and Coated. Uncoated ELISA kits include all the necessary reagents to coat your own plates and run your assay with maximum flexibility. Coated ELISA kits are ready-to-use and quality tested for sensitivity, specificity, precision and lot-to-lot consistency.

Melatonin is a hormone primarily released by the pineal gland at night, and has long been associated with control of the sleep–wake cycle. In vertebrates, melatonin is involved in synchronizing circadian rhythms, including sleep–wake timing and blood pressure regulation, and controls seasonal rhythmicity including reproduction, fattening, moulting, and hibernation
